2013-07-22 2 views
-1

저는 서버에서 일부 데이터, 매개 변수를 가져 오는 중입니다. 매개 변수가 필요한 코드에 제출되었으므로 XE4에서 Windows를 테스트 한 결과 오류가 발생하면 정상적으로 작동합니다. HttpEncode (UTF8Encode ('some Chinese')) 코딩 결과는 Windows 및 IOS에서 동일하지 않습니다. 나는 똑같은 결과를 얻지 못할 것이고 수신 된 서버에 제출하면 깨진 것입니다. 모두가 저를 도와 줄 수 있습니까?중국 URL 창과 IOS 인코딩이 다릅니다

+0

* what *을 (를) 살펴보세요. – borrrden

+0

우리에게 보여주십시오 : a) 어디서 왔는지, b) 서버로 보내는 방법, c) 서버가받는 것. 또한 '일부 중국어'가 아닌 실제 한자 문자열입니다. – Martijn

+0

질문 작성에 도움이 될 수 있습니까? 나는 영어가 모국어가 아님을 알 수 있습니다. 이것은 이해하기 어려운 질문입니다. –

답변

0

내가 무슨 문제인지 이해할 수 없지만 텍스트 인코딩 - 디코딩 불일치가있는 것 같습니다. 나는 당신이 텍스트를 직접 인코딩하는 것을 이해하지만, 두 목적지 (윈도우와 아이오와)는 다르게 그것을 디코딩하고있다. 나는 아랍어와 함께이 문제를 가지고 내가이 글을 읽을 때까지 무슨 일이 일어 났는지 이해하지 못했다 :

http://www.joelonsoftware.com/articles/Unicode.html

이 그런 삶을 다시 좋았다. 이 도움이되기를 바랍니다 :)

관련 문제